The southernmost town on Hatteras Island and one of the few villages in the Cape Hatteras National Seashore (the first National Seashore in the United States), Hatteras Village is home to the Graveyard of the Atlantic Museum (the waters here have historically wreaked havoc on ships) and some of the finest seafood on the coast. Coastal mapping done by the Federal Emergency Management Agency in 1999 determined that the 65% of the Southern Shores of North Carolina were eroding with the highest rates being 11.5 ft/year. In 1999, after several years of debate and lawsuits aimed at blocking relocation, the National Park Service successfully moved the lighthouse back 2,900 feet at a cost of $9.8 million.
